A circuit construction kit typically consists of components such as batteries, resistors, wires, switches, and sometimes bulbs or motors. Each of these elements plays a unique role in the functioning of a circuit. For instance, batteries act as the source of voltage, providing the necessary potential difference to push current through the circuit. Resistors limit the flow of current, allowing for control over how much electricity passes through.

By combining these elements, users can create various configurations to observe the behavior of electricity in real time.

Components of a DC Circuit Construction Kit

Understanding the various components of a DC circuit construction kit is crucial for experimenting with and learning about electric circuits. Here are the key components typically included in these kits:

  • Batteries: Serve as the power source, providing the voltage needed to drive current through the circuit.
  • Resistors: Control the flow of electricity by providing resistance, which can be adjusted to see its effect on current and voltage.
  • Wires: Conduct electricity between components, often color-coded to differentiate between positive and negative connections.
  • Switches: Allow users to open or close the circuit, enabling control over the flow of current.
  • Light bulbs or LEDs: Act as indicators for current flow, illuminating when electricity passes through.
  • Multimeters: Measure voltage, current, and resistance within the circuit to provide quantitative feedback on performance.

The combination of these components enables users to construct various circuits, facilitating a deeper understanding of how electric circuits work.

Illustrating Fundamental Concepts of Electric Circuits

Circuit construction kits are invaluable for demonstrating fundamental electrical concepts such as voltage, current, and resistance. These concepts can be observed through various circuit configurations, which can be modified to illustrate their interrelationships. To highlight these relationships, it is essential to understand Ohm’s Law, expressed as:

I = V/R

Where:

  • I is the current in amperes (A)
  • V is the voltage in volts (V)
  • R is the resistance in ohms (Ω)

This law forms the foundation of circuit analysis and enables users to predict how changes in one component affect the overall circuit behavior. For instance, increasing resistance while keeping voltage constant results in a decrease in current, showcasing the inverse relationship dictated by Ohm’s Law.Through experimentation with circuit construction kits, learners can visualize the effects of altering voltage and resistance on current flow.

By adding or removing components, they can observe real-time changes and gain insights into the principles that govern electrical systems in everyday life, from simple flashlight circuits to complex electronic devices. Interactive Learning Experience

The interactive nature of the PHET simulation significantly contributes to student engagement and comprehension in circuit construction. Key features that enhance this experience include:

  • Real-time feedback: As students create and modify circuits, they receive immediate feedback on circuit functionality, allowing for instant corrections and explorations of outcomes.
  • Adjustable parameters: Users can easily change component values, such as resistance and voltage, to observe how these adjustments impact current flow and overall circuit behavior.
  • Multiple circuit configurations: The simulation allows for the creation of series and parallel circuits, helping students understand the differences and applications of each configuration.
  • Visual aids: Graphs and meters display real-time data on voltage, current, and resistance, reinforcing the connection between theoretical concepts and practical application.

The advantages of using virtual simulations like the PHET circuit construction kit over physical kits are numerous. Virtual simulations eliminate the costs associated with purchasing physical components and minimize the possibility of accidents, such as short circuits or component damage. Furthermore, students can experiment at their own pace without the constraints of time, space, or equipment limitations. This accessibility increases the likelihood of achieving learning outcomes, as students can repeatedly practice and reinforce their understanding of circuit principles without financial burden or physical limitations.

Common Mistakes to Avoid When Assembling Circuits

When assembling circuits, it’s important to be aware of potential pitfalls. Here’s a list of common mistakes to avoid to ensure successful circuit assembly:

Incorrect Wiring

Double-check connections to avoid miswiring, which can prevent the circuit from functioning.

Reversed Polarities

Ensure that components like batteries and diodes are connected with the correct polarity.

Using Incorrect Resistor Values

Verify resistor values before connecting to prevent excessive current and potential damage to components.

Loose Connections

Ensure all jumper wires are securely connected to avoid intermittent contact.

Ignoring Safety Precautions

Always follow safety guidelines, especially when dealing with higher voltage circuits.
